Your Search For Pet Insurance Is Over

Pets can get sick, just like humans. And just like people, pets need care to keep them going strong. Caring for your pet's unexpected injuries or troubling health issues can require medications and surgery—and those bills can add up! Getting your furry friends the kind of care they need shouldn’t require going into debt. The last thing we need to stress over when our beloved pets need care is the cost to help them heal. Unfortunately, many pet owners find themselves facing tough decisions about their dog’s or cat’s care.
